Two Kingston Athletic Club and polytechnic Harriers members will get up close and personal with Olympic athletes after being selected as technical officials for the 2012 Games.
Brenda Ford, a track judge, and Peter Shilling, a starter, will start work helping with the track and field athletics on Friday.
Throughout the games the duo will work in the Olympic Stadium call room putting athletes through important checks, making sure they are wearing the correct clothing, not displaying any illegal
advertising and have the right numbers.
Mr Shilling said: “To be involved in any part of the Olympics is an honour. To be on home soil is incredible.”
